If byx=1.6\displaystyle b_{yx} = 1.6 and bxy=0.4\displaystyle b_{xy} = 0.4, then rxy\displaystyle r_{xy} will be:

Options

A0.4
B0.8
C0.64
D-0.8

Detailed Solution & Explanation

The relationship between the correlation coefficient (rxy\displaystyle r_{xy}) and the regression coefficients (byx\displaystyle b_{yx} and bxy\displaystyle b_{xy}) is given by:
rxy2=byx×bxyr_{xy}^2 = b_{yx} \times b_{xy}
Taking the square root on both sides:
rxy=±byx×bxyr_{xy} = \pm \sqrt{b_{yx} \times b_{xy}}

Given:
- byx=1.6\displaystyle b_{yx} = 1.6
- bxy=0.4\displaystyle b_{xy} = 0.4

Substitute these values into the formula:
rxy=±1.6×0.4r_{xy} = \pm \sqrt{1.6 \times 0.4}
rxy=±0.64r_{xy} = \pm \sqrt{0.64}
rxy=±0.8r_{xy} = \pm 0.8

Since both regression coefficients byx\displaystyle b_{yx} and bxy\displaystyle b_{xy} are positive, the correlation coefficient rxy\displaystyle r_{xy} must also be positive. Therefore:
rxy=0.8r_{xy} = 0.8

Hence, **Option B** is the correct answer.
